1. Please be nice to him. This is the more common and natural way to express the idea. It's a straightforward request to treat the person kindly. It's used when you want someone to show good behavior, politeness, and consideration toward another person. 2. Please be nice with him. While this phrasing is grammatically correct, it's a bit less common. In English, the typical preposition to use after "be nice" is "to," as in "be nice to someone."
